What Are Weight Loss Supplements?
Weight loss supplements are products designed to help people lose weight by boosting metabolism, reducing appetite, or increasing fat burning. They come in various forms, including pills, powders, teas, and liquids. Common ingredients include caffeine, green tea extract, Garcinia Cambogia, L-carnitine, and fiber.
How Do They Work?
These supplements generally work through three main mechanisms:
-
Appetite Suppression: Ingredients like glucomannan or certain proteins help you feel fuller, reducing overall calorie intake.
-
Fat Burning: Thermogenic compounds such as caffeine or capsaicin increase the body’s calorie-burning rate.
-
Carbohydrate and Fat Absorption Reduction: Some supplements inhibit enzymes that break down fats or carbs, limiting calorie absorption.

Risks and Considerations
While weight loss supplements can be helpful, they are not magic solutions. Some risks include:
-
Side Effects: Jitters, increased heart rate, digestive issues, or sleep disturbances from stimulants.
-
Interactions with Medications: Certain supplements may interfere with prescription drugs.
-
False Claims: Many products exaggerate effectiveness or lack scientific backing.
